Przez komiks i animację do wiedzy ekonomicznej
Komiksy, animacje i scenariusze lekcji, przygotowane przez metodyków z Ośrodka Rozwoju Edukacji we współpracy z ekonomistami Fundacji FOR, będą dystrybuowane bezpłatnie wśród nauczycieli szkół gimnazjalnych i ponadgimnazjalnych, prowadzących lekcje z podstaw przedsiębiorczości i wiedzy o społeczeństwie. Wspomniane materiały będą dostępne dla nauczycieli na stronie internetowej FOR.
